Output e9505ebe63608678ce1ffa2a4a6d85b0ee6e4f4c1005133589b45d51a09021cd:1

value
6940433067042
script pubkey
OP_0 OP_PUSHBYTES_20 8b558b853cd87576b003026f822752a027306b56
address
tb1q3d2chpfump6hdvqrqfhcyf6j5qnnq66kzxv8qm
transaction
e9505ebe63608678ce1ffa2a4a6d85b0ee6e4f4c1005133589b45d51a09021cd
confirmations
167085
spent
true